Could smaller AI models make software testing easier for banks?

Scott Zoldi

As banks accelerate the deployment of generative AI, one of the biggest gains for software testing teams may come not from increasingly powerful large language models, but from using smaller, purpose-built AI models that are easier to validate, monitor and govern.

At least, that is the view of Scott Zoldi, who works for analytics software provider FICO, whose technology is used by banks, insurers and financial institutions worldwide for areas including credit scoring, fraud detection, decision management and risk analytics.

Zoldi thinks banks should at least test and trial smaller, tailored AI infrastructure as financial firms should move away from relying on general-purpose AI models for business-critical decisions and instead deploy smaller models trained exclusively for specific financial services use cases.

According to the FICO chief analytics officer, that approach not only reduces computing costs but could also simplify software testing, model validation and regulatory compliance in an increasingly demanding supervisory environment.

Zoldi argued that today’s frontier AI models are not yet suitable for many regulated financial applications.

“The open models that are out there today and the global models that are out there today don’t meet the standards of responsible AI,” he explained to website The AI Innovator.

“They need to get to robust AI, explainable AI, ethical AI and auditable AI to ensure that the basic data science practices we’ve been doing for decades are not violated.”

Rather than attempting to validate models trained on vast amounts of internet data, banks could focus on testing models designed around narrowly defined business domains such as lending, fraud detection, anti-money laundering or customer servicing, Zoldi stressed.

A smaller testing surface makes it easier to perform regression testing, explainability assessments and model validation, while reducing the number of unpredictable outputs that must be evaluated before deployment.

It also simplifies demonstrating evidence of governance to regulators, who are placing increasing emphasis on explainability, auditability and operational resilience in AI systems.

Zoldi believes the scope of the model itself is fundamental to achieving those goals. “If you’re a financial services firm, you do not need a model that’s built on Spice Girls lyrics. You do not need a model to tell you how to change a tire. You need a model that only knows about financial services.”

He also questions the growing enterprise trend of connecting proprietary banking data to large, general-purpose models through retrieval augmented generation (RAG) or extensive fine-tuning.

“A large commoditised model has seen the entire totality of all the data known to mankind,” Zoldi continued. “So how do we think that we’re going to persuade it to ignore everything that it has learned? By prompting correctly? How do you have confidence in that?”

Instead, he advocates building multiple specialised AI models, each trained for a single business task using carefully curated datasets and validated examples rather than historical operational data that may itself contain bias or poor decisions.

Focus on performance

According to Zoldi, these smaller models can outperform much larger general-purpose systems on financial tasks because they are trained exclusively on relevant knowledge.

Perhaps the most interesting proposal from a software testing perspective is FICO’s “trust score” architecture, which effectively creates an additional layer of automated AI quality assurance.

Rather than relying solely on confidence scores generated by the primary AI model, FICO proposes deploying a second AI model that independently evaluates the first before responses are delivered.

Business specialists, compliance professionals, lawyers and risk experts define “knowledge anchors” describing how particular scenarios should be handled. The secondary model then assesses whether responses align with those approved standards before assigning a numerical trust score.

For banks, this effectively introduces continuous AI validation rather than relying solely on testing before deployment.

It also creates a new challenge for quality engineering teams: how should the validation model itself be tested, monitored and regression-tested as the primary AI model evolves?

As organisations increasingly deploy AI to verify other AI systems, software assurance is itself becoming a multi-layered discipline, Zoldi pointed out.

Cost is another important part of FICO’s argument. Smaller, domain-specific models require significantly less computing infrastructure and reduce dependence on expensive third-party AI services.

“That’s not hard. Get your PyTorch,” Zoldi said, adding that “you don’t need a lot of GPUs.” Recalling FICO’s own experience, he said: “It’s not a big investment.”

For financial institutions, however, the savings may extend well beyond infrastructure. Smaller, specialised AI models could also reduce the cost of software testing and model assurance by making validation exercises more targeted, explainability easier to demonstrate and governance evidence simpler to produce.

At a time when regulators around the world are demanding greater confidence in how banks develop, test and monitor AI systems, that combination of lower operating costs and easier assurance could prove just as valuable as any reduction in GPU expenditure.
